Loading classes...

Browse our extensive catalog of courses. Use filters to find the perfect class for your needs and interests.

Pick your favorite course and grab your spot before it's full. Experience group learning, which means more friends and better prices.

We'll send you a link to where your group will meet so you're ready for day one. Enjoy your time with your class!
Character design online class covering visual storytelling, shape language, color theory, and pro workflows for animation and film.
Online spiritual growth class focused on self-discovery, healing, meditation, and personal transformation in a safe, non-judgmental space.
Discover Japanese culture through brush and language. Join our japanese calligraphy online class to learn writing, art, and expression.
Join this online military history class with Dr. Sascha Möbius. Explore the reality of war, soldier psychology, and myths from 1618–1815.
Learn card reading online with a beginner-friendly class using ordinary playing cards to grow intuition for love, happiness and success.
Master the world's fastest learning techniques. Join our speed reading online class to double your reading speed and sharpen your memory.
Master digital art in our digital portrait painting online class. Learn Photoshop brush techniques and professional workflows from an expert.
Discover the joy of creating with Savage Art Lessons, where you'll master techniques like acrylic painting, ink drawing, and more, guided by an experienced artist in a fun and supportive environment.
Join Natalie in this live online guitar class for beginners and learn chords, rhythm, and how to play your favorite songs with confidence.
Join an online cooking class for a mindful, honest meal. Learn professional techniques for simple proteins and vegetables with care.
Discover yourself through creativity in this healing art online class. Reflect, draw, and express emotions through mindful illustration.
A journaling online class for reflecting on memories, sharing experiences, and exploring personal insights in a safe, guided space.
Build clarity and calm. Join our online meditation class to master breathwork, mantras, and visualization with expert guide Marilyn Joy.
Stop reacting and start leading. Join our online neuroscience life coaching class to rewire thought patterns and build lasting resilience.
Join Natalie’s live online piano class for beginners and learn music theory, note reading, and more. No experience needed!
Join this Unity game programming online class for beginners. Learn C#, build projects, and create your first game with expert guidance.
Build a strong foundation in programming with this beginner-friendly course. Learn coding basics and start your journey into web development!
This course will teach you how to build scalable, server-side applications using Next.js and PostgreSQL, with a focus on SQL, APIs, and backend logic, a step in preparing you for a full-stack role. Programming and coding program that can be taken before or after the React frontend mini bootcamp.
Learn the world's most popular frontend web development framework, React. Improve your JavaScript for full-stack development & applied programming.
Master the features and capabilities of ChatGPT. In this two-hour session, you'll learn practical tips and strategies to maximize your productivity and creativity with this powerful AI technology. From image generation to audio editing to computer programming, ChatGPT can massively improve your workload.
Build a strong foundation in programming with this beginner-friendly course. Learn coding basics and start your journey into web development!
Interested in trying out computer science and seeing if it's right for you? Experience the basics of web development & data science. JavaScript/Python.
Our teachers list their classes on PassionClass people they care and already know their topic. Want to learn about sewing? We've got that. Improve comedy? Got that too. A foreign language? Take your pick.
We're an open marketplace so anyone (including YOU) can share what they know a lot about. At present, we interview all of our teachers to make sure they're up to snuff. Our average class so far has a 4.8/5 review.


We just don't believe you can learn through apps. Do you know anyone who can really speak a foreign language after using Duolingo?
Relationships are the key to learning. In PassionClass, you've got someone teaching you live from day 1, and a group of friends to grow with from the very beginning.